An attractive tax system for foreign investors
Mauritius offers very favorable taxation: income tax capped at 15%, no property tax, no housing tax and no inheritance tax on real estate. The government encourages foreign investment through schemes such as the Property Development Scheme (PDS), allowing non-citizens to acquire real estate and obtain a residence permit.
A dynamic real estate market with strong appreciation
The Mauritian real estate sector, particularly in the luxury segment, is booming. Thanks to growing demand from international investors (Europe, South Africa, India, etc.), properties increase in value in the medium to long term. The island is also a major tourist destination, which supports rental investment, especially in prestige residences with hotel services.
